Itinerary

30 min

Begin with a guided stroll through the bustling aisles, where you’ll be introduced to the market’s role as a hub for fresh seafood, locally grown vegetables, and premium meats, including renowned Japanese wagyu beef. Learn about its transition from a wholesale market to the heart of Kanazawa’s food scene.

70 min

Relish the unique opportunity to sample freshly prepared seafood, fruits, and more at renowned stalls like Oguchi Suisan and Fruits Sakano. Enjoy both takeout and eat-in options, featuring seasonal delicacies from the Sea of Japan, local produce, and mouthwatering wagyu dishes. If time allows, visit specialty shops offering the best local gifts, from traditional sweets to artisanal products.

Eat everything!

This is our first time in Japan and we couldn't have asked for a better tour guide. We met Katie at the entrance to the Market, and straight away she brought us in and gave us a general tour of the markets and the booths, pointing out various specialties of Kanazawa. We took note of the items we wanted to try and afterward we'd just point to something and Katie would order it for us. (Black throat perch, hairy crab, famous croquettes, grapes, taiyaki, noto beef). I loved the fact that she also showed us how to eat the crab, why choosing the femaile one is better, or explaining why the croquettes were famous (celebrity approved). While everyone goes for kobe or wagyu beef, which are also available, we chose the vendor selling noto which is local to Kanazawa and just as good. Come with an appetite - we were worried the alotted 3k yen per person wouldn't be enough but we were pleasantly stuffed with everything we wanted to try. And if we wanted to try more, if we went over our budget we'd just pay out of pocket. We had time left after eating, so Katie walked us across the market to the shops and showed us around the different stores. Overall an amazing way to spend the afternoon with a local.
